Annie Davison is an astute observer of life and its multiplicity of meanings. Her writing style is totally readable, and her approach to change is inspirational. An increasing number of us know that it is time to change. We know that we need to make changes in how we relate to each other, to the earth; to the modern economy and the material world. Spiritual teachers, and numerous self-help books tell us to live in the 'now', but few explain how to change, how to live in the now, or how exactly our personal and collective lives will be enhanced by doing so: If you are one of those who want to know more about living more effectively in this time we call 'now', and have deeper understanding of the nature of the changes we need to make and participate in at every level, then I recommend you read Annie Davison's book 'A Time to Change: A guide to life after greed'. --(Ruth White, transpersonal psychologist, spiritual consultant, channel and author.)
I have experienced Annie Davison's work as a counsellor, teacher and author with exceptional results. Annie's book provides an exploration of many new concepts that will affect our current world view. It stimulates new insights for those who struggle with fears of an unknown future, and for all of us who must focus on major planetary changes. --(Soozi Holbeche, renowned author and healer)
